Cameron Smith's Favourite Origin: Against All Odds 07.06.2026 31minNo player has worn the Queensland jersey more times than Cameron Smith. Across 42 State of Origin appearances, Smith became the ultimate competitor, captain and match-winner, helping lead the Maroons through one of the most dominant eras in rugby league history. But when asked to choose his favourite Origin, Smith doesn't go back to the beginning. He picks 2017. It was a series that seemed destined for New South Wales after a crushing Game One victory in Brisbane against a Queensland side missing Billy Slater, Cooper Cronk and Johnathan Thurston. Then came Thurston's unforgettable sideline conversion in Sydney despite a shattered shoulder. And finally, a decider in Brisbane that would become Smith's last ever game for Queensland. In this episode of Stories of Origin, Cameron Smith relives the highs, the pressure, the leadership challenges and the moments that made the 2017 series his most memorable Origin campaign. Fatty’s Miracle: 30 Years Since Queensland’s Greatest Origin Upset 08.07.2025 31minIt was 1995 - the height of the Super League war. As the ARL blacklisted players aligned with Super League, Queensland was left with a team of virtual unknowns and a first-time coach, Paul ‘Fatty’ Vautin. No one expected them to win. Facing a New South Wales side stacked with international stars, the Maroons were written off before a ball was kicked. But what happened next became legend. Magic Moments: Turvey Triumphant 18.05.2025 25minAfter five painful years of Maroon dominance, 1985 was the year New South Wales said “enough.” They turned to Canterbury’s fearless halfback Steve “Turvey” Mortimer - a man with blue blood and an unbreakable will - to lead the charge. From stirring pre-game speeches to that unforgettable chair-lift off the SCG, Mortimer’s passion and grit didn’t just win a series - he rewrote Origin history and brought the Blues their first ever series win. Alfie & The Greatest Origin Comeback 26.05.2024 24minAfter a humiliating defeat in the 2000 State of Origin series, Queensland turned to legendary coach Wayne Bennett to restore state pride. Bennett's bold move to select an entirely new Maroons team paid off with a victory in the opening game of the 2001 series. However, the Blues fought back, leveling the series with a dominant performance in game two. With the decider looming, Queensland needed a spark. Enter Allan Langer. St George Can't Play... Alfie and the Beginning of the Broncos 19.05.2024 25minAllan Langer’s playing legacy still looms large over the Broncos. The clubs Inaugural halfback in 1988 would become their first premiership captain in ‘92, a title they defended in ‘93. He’d go on to lead a team rated among the greatest club outfits ever assembled to the Super League premiership of ‘97, and in ‘98 they reigned supreme again in a reunited 20 team competition. It’s a career so profound that Langer is immortalised in bronze with his own statue at Lang Park alongside fellow QLD champions, Lewis, Lockyer, Beetson and Meninga. JT & Adam Mogg - An Unlikely Hero 28.05.2023 31minIt can take just one play to make someone an Origin hero. In the case of Adam Mogg, his two games for Queensland are as significant as any. In 2006, State of Origin was in its 25th year. New South Wales was coming off its third straight series victory and there was growing concern about the long-term future of State of Origin, as many commentators were beginning to wonder if Queensland would ever win another series. Up step the Toowoomba product, Adam Mogg. In this episode of Stories of Origin, Adam Mogg and Jonathan Thurston sit down to discuss the 2006 series, the adversity they had to overcome, and the unlikely hero that would help trigger a decade of Queensland dominance.
